The European Food Safety Authority has taken in more than 156 innovative food applications for substances such as apple cell cultures and mung bean proteins since January 2018, when new EU legislation took effect, aiming to make it easier for businesses to bring their unusual products to market. Of those 156114 are still under consideration, 39 were approved and three were rejected, officials said.
More products have been submitted for approval since 2018 than in prior 14 years combined.

But their cash-burning tactics to attract users and uncertain business models turned out to be unsustainable. By 2017, the bubble was already bursting – yet another casualty in big tech’s seemingly endless proxy wars for users and market share, leaving a trail of broken companies, and bikes, in their wake.
Mobike officially halted operations of the mobile app and WeChat mini programme under its own brand last week, fully merging under its parent company Meituan.

Mr. Madden is recently retired as a Managing Director of Credit Suisse/Holt after a career in money management and investment research that included the founding of Callard Madden & Associates. During his career, he developed the cash-flow return on investment (CFROI) valuation framework that is widely used today by money management firms worldwide.
Mr. Madden is currently an independent researcher and a Senior Fellow at the National Center for Policy Analysis (NCPA). His research has focused on the themes of knowledge building and wealth creation being able to exist simultaneously in businesses, and these themes are represented in his various books including — Value Creation Principles: The Pragmatic Theory of the Firm Begins with Purpose and Ends with Sustainable Capitalism, Wealth Creation: A Systems Mindset for Building and Investing in Businesses for the Long Term, and Reconstructing Your Worldview: The Four Core Beliefs You Need to Solve Complex Business Problems.
Mr. Madden is a proponent of the application of systems thinking to public policy, and his work in public policy has resulted in the Free To Choose Medicine (http://freetochoosemedicine.com/) plan, which was originally developed in journal articles published in Regulation, Cancer Biotherapy & Radiopharmaceuticals, and Medical Hypotheses.

NASA scientists and their colleagues are now proposing corporate financing for a human mission to Mars. This raises the prospect that a spaceship named the Microsoft Explorer or the Google Search Engine could one day go down in history as the first spaceship to bring humans to the Red Planet.
The proposal suggests that companies could drum up $160 billion for a human mission to Mars and a colony there, rather than having governments fund such a mission with tax dollars.
Joel Levine, a senior research scientist at NASA Langley Research Center, was quoted in a release in the Journal of Cosmology by Dr. Rhawn Joseph. The plan covers “every aspect of a journey to the Red Planet — the design of the spacecrafts, medical health and psychological issues, the establishment of a Mars base, colonization, and a revolutionary business proposal to overcome the major budgetary obstacles which have prevented the U.S. from sending astronauts to Mars,” said Levine.
A team of researchers affiliated with several institutions in the U.K. and one in Saudi Arabia has developed a way to produce jet fuel using carbon dioxide as a main ingredient. In their paper published in the journal Nature Communications, the group describes their process and its efficiency.
As scientists continue to look for ways to reduce the amount of carbon dioxide emitted into the atmosphere, they have increasingly focused on certain business sectors. One of those sectors is the aviation industry, which accounts for approximately 12% of transportation-related carbon dioxide emissions. Curbing carbon emissions in the aviation industry has proved to be challenging due to the difficulty of fitting heavy batteries inside of aircraft. In this new effort, the researchers have developed a chemical process that can be used to produce carbon-neutral jet fuel.
The researchers used a process called the organic combustion method to convert carbon dioxide in the air into jet fuel and other products. It involved using an iron catalyst (with added potassium and manganese) along with hydrogen, citric acid and carbon dioxide heated to 350 degrees C. The process forced the carbon atoms apart from the oxygen atoms in CO2 molecules, which then bonded with hydrogen atoms, producing the kind of hydrocarbon molecules that comprise liquid jet fuel. The process also resulted in the creation of water molecules and other products.
